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Heswall to Ely start from as little as £37.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ities at Heswall Station

While Heswall Station may not boast an array of services, it does offer essentials for travelers. You'll find step-free access to platforms, making it a viable option for those with mobility issues. However, be aware that there is no ticket office or machines for purchasing or collecting tickets onsite. The absence of a waiting room or toilets may encourage travelers to plan ahead before arriving at the station. Fortunately, seating is available should you require a moment to rest before your journey.

Onward Journey Options

Despite its limited facilities, Heswall station is well-supported by local transport links. The nearest bus stops are conveniently situated just outside the station car park, enhancing your options for onward journeys. While there's no provision for bicycle storage or hire, the ease of connectivity with local buses can effectively bridge the gap for eco-conscious travelers choosing public transport.

Facilities and Amenities

Ely Train Station is well-equipped to cater to the needs of all passengers. Those purchasing or collecting tickets will find it a breeze with ticket machines and an open ticket office available throughout the week. Accessibility is a major highlight with step-free access provided to all platforms via a ramped subway, meeting the ORR's category A standards for station accessibility. There are also acc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and staff assistance to ensure that all customers can travel with ease.

While you wait for your train, take advantage of the waiting rooms, which are accessible across various platforms and open for extended hours. Refreshment facilities, a newsagent, and a large Tesco supermarket next door provide convenient options for buying snacks or essentials. Don't worry about connectivity as free public Wi-Fi is available to keep you online throughout your journey.
